Output 61c24f6abd5a39719247654af62dc3353894d68466b2c3c99e4d0f2903eaffd7:3

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ebaf6e35f8aec6f6ef9386664ad5c14bcfce63e OP_EQUALVERIFY OP_CHECKSIG
address
12LtSCd1Tjizpgi5XHvoiE5RAREVs47NVx
transaction
61c24f6abd5a39719247654af62dc3353894d68466b2c3c99e4d0f2903eaffd7
spent
true